How the Technological Advances Can Change Our Lives

Phone craze

In 1876 the first telephone was created . During that time only scientists and the 1 percent of the population were able to permit themselves such a luxury item. Edison/Berliner transmitter gave people the ability to communicate with their peers who were in different house holds. Many believed that this was the final frontier of communication. However, the inception of cell phones surpassed all expectations. Initially the mobile phones were so big that people preferred to have them built in their vehicles. Current cell phone is a whole different animal. In contrast to their ancestors our mobile phones are weightless and cost nothing.

Theyve become so accessible that its normal for a child or a senior to have one. Words like Smart Phones and Reverse phone look ups have become part of our vocabularies. Some 3rd world countries are seriously considering providing their citizens exclusively with mobile networks instead of land ones. It costs less to build a network of cellular phone towers than to create a landline network.

What people should know

Cell phones are great. But public needs to pay close attention to how they evolve. For example previous reverse phone look ups, allowed you to get the individuals name and static address. But some of todays reverse cell phone traces allow you to get the exact location of the person who is carrying the cell phone. This can be a major security risk.

But then again, if you are only inquiring about the location of your child it can be an indispensable service. Reverse mobile tracing is just one of the issues. Scientists are still debating if prolonged exposure to cell phone waves is linked to cases of brain tumours.
